疏肝健脾活血方对大鼠肝星状细胞TGF-β1Smads信号通路的影响

中文摘要:
      目的:探讨疏肝健脾活血方含药血清对活化的大鼠肝星状细胞TGF-β1/Smads信号通路相关基因表达的影响。方法:沉默Smad4基因得到Smad4 RNAi HSCs-T6细胞株后与HSCs-T6细胞株分别随机分组,HSCs-T6细胞株分为空白对照组(N组)、TGF-β1模型组(T组)、TGF-β1 含药血清组(TH组);Smad4 RNAi HSCs-T6细胞株分为Smad4 RNAi HSCs-T6细胞分组为:Smad4 RNAi组(S组)、 Smad4RNAi TGF-β1模型组(ST组)、Smad4 RNAi TGF-β1 含药血清组(STH组),用含药血清干预后采用ELISA法检测大鼠肝星状细胞中Ⅰ型胶原含量的变化;RT-PCR法检测HSC-T6细胞中Smad2、Smad3、Smad4、Smad7 mRNA的相对表达量。结果:TGF-β1促进HSC的I型胶原及Smad2、Smad3、Smad7的表达(P<0.01或P<0.05),含药血清干预下HSC的I型胶原及Smad2、Smad3、Smad4、Smad7表达下调(P<0.01或P<0.05),沉默Smads4基因后得到相同结果(P<0.01或P<0.05)。结论:疏肝健脾活血方在离体条件下可以延缓肝纤维化的进程,其机制可能与阻断TGF-β1/Smads信号通路有关。
英文摘要:
      Objective:To explore the effect of serum containing Shugan Jianpi Huoxue Decoction on the expression of TGF-β1/Smads pathway genes in activated rat HSC. Methods: Smad4 RNAi HSCs-T6 were obtained by using lentiviral vector to silent Smad4 gene in HSCs-T6. Then HSCs-T6 and Smad4 RNAi HSCs-T6 were randomly grouped, respectively.The specific groups were as follows:HSCs-T6 were divided into control group(N),model group(T) and serum containing medicine group(TH);Smad4 RNAi HSCs-T6 were divided into Smad4 RNAi group(S), Smad4 RNAi model group(ST) and Smad4 RNAi serum containing medicine group(STH). After the intervention of serum containing medicine, the collagenⅠ in HSCs was measured by ELISA ;RT-PCR was used to detect the relative expression of Smad2, Smad3, Smad4 and Smad7 mRNA in HSC. Results:TGF-β1 significantly promotes the expression of collagenⅠ and genes of Smad2/Smad3/Smad7 in HSC(P<0.01 or P<0.05).After the intervention of serum containing medicine,the expression of collagenⅠ and genes of Smad2/Smad3/Smad4/Smad7 were significantly declined(P<0.01 or P<0.05), as well as the silence of Smad4 gene(P<0.01 or P<0.05). Conclusion:Shugan Jianpi Huoxue Decoction can retard the liver fibrosis in vitro, and the mechanism may be related to blocking TGF-β1/Smads pathway.
